How to Reset Home Screen on iPhone 

Even though it might sound terrifying, you should not be afraid to reset the home screen on your iPhone. This differs from wiping your iPhone clean and starting over. You can reset your Home Screen to its original appearance, which was included with your current iOS version. Only your customized folders and any customized Home Screen widgets will be deleted.

Your iPhone will reorder all installed apps alphabetically after the built-in Apple apps on your Home screen rather than using your personalized layout. The only constant is the wallpaper you are using right now.

  • Go to Settings  > General > Transfer or Reset iPhone.
  • Tap Reset, tap Reset Home Screen Layout, 
  • Then tap “Reset Home Screen”.

Your newly downloaded apps are listed alphabetically after the ones that came pre-installed on your iPhone, and any folders you have created are deleted. Once you have completed the final step, your iPhone will immediately return to its standard Home Screen layout. How to Reset Home Screen Layout on Android

There is a unique launcher included with every Android device. Finding the name of the default launcher and then wiping its data are prerequisites for performing a factory reset, which will return your home screen to its factory settings. Other Android devices lack a built-in feature to clear the home screen, such as Samsung Galaxy phones. You must clean out the default launcher’s data. Older and newer Android phones require slightly different steps.

The instructions below will help you locate the name of your phone’s default launcher.

  • Launch the Android Settings app.
  • Choose Apps by scrolling down.
  • Default apps > Home app
  • The default launcher of your Android phone will be selected.

Following the steps below will allow you to restore your original Android theme and clear launcher data.

  • On your smartphone, tap Settings.
  • Select Apps.
  • Look through the list of apps and find the default launcher. Then select it.
  • Choose Storage usage (Or Storage & cache).
  • To start over with a new home screen layout, choose Clear data (Clear storage).

Resetting App Layout on Old Android Phones (Method 2)

If your phone runs an earlier version of Android than Android 10, the method from above might not function. In that case, erasing the data linked to the Google app will allow you to reset the home screen layout on an Android device. Here’s how to do that:

  • Navigate to Settings > Apps > Google on your Android device.
  • Open Storage > Manage space.
  • Go to the Clear Launcher Data option.

Any adjustments you have made to the launcher will be lost if you clear its data and reset the home screen. This includes all of the pages on your home screen as well as any widgets or newly added app icons, folders, etc. It will bring back the original design, as seen on modern phones. Therefore, the home screen will only display the most basic app icons.

How to Reset Home Screen Layout Samsung

There is no built-in option to reset the home screen layout on Samsung smartphones like the Samsung Galaxy. Clearing the data from the Samsung launcher will, however, yield the same results. You can only clear data using the same methods after choosing One UI Home or Samsung Experience Home from the list of apps.

Your phone’s home screen should then appear exactly as it did when you first got it.

Samsung Galaxy phones lack a built-in feature that would allow you to reset the home screen layout. To return the Samsung launcher’s home screen layout to its default settings, you must clear its data.

Take the following actions to restore your Samsung Galaxy phone’s home screen to its original state:

  • The first step is to open the Settings app on your Samsung Galaxy phone.
  • Navigate to Apps.
  • Locate One UI Home (for newer phones) or Samsung Experience Home (for older phones) by scrolling down and tapping on them.
  • On the following screen, tap Storage, then select Clear data.

Where Is Home Screen Settings?

Start by going to the home screen of your Android device. A pop-up menu will then appear after you tap and hold on an empty section of the screen. Choose “Home Settings” from the list of choices.

How Do I Refresh My Screen Display?

Simply restarting the device is one approach. By holding down the power button while it is lit up, you can restart your device by tapping Restart after the power menu appears.

Resetting your device to factory settings is another way to refresh it. In addition to wiping all data and customizations, this will return the device to its default factory settings. Resetting a device to factory settings will erase all of its data, so you should only do it as a last resort.
